The Red Clay Strays: From Mobile to the Main Stage

The story of The Red Clay Strays really begins in Mobile, Alabama, back in 2016. It’s a pretty interesting start, actually, as the band grew out of a cover band. This means the musicians were already playing together, building chemistry and learning how to perform for an audience, which is a great foundation for any group. The decision to move from playing other artists' songs to creating their own original music is a significant step, showing a desire to forge their own path and share their unique artistic voice. This kind of evolution is, in a way, a testament to their collective creative spirit.

The core of the band, when they first formed as The Red Clay Strays, included Brandon Coleman on lead vocals and guitar, Andrew Bishop on bass, and Drew Nix on guitar. This initial lineup laid the groundwork for the powerful sound they would develop. Over time, the band expanded, adding more talented musicians to fill out their sound and stage presence. The addition of Zach Rishel on electric guitar and John Hall on drums completed the lineup that many fans know today. Each member brings their own feel and talent to the group, creating a rich and layered musical experience for listeners.

Frequently Asked Questions

Who is the lead singer of The Red Clay Strays?

The lead singer of The Red Clay Strays is Brandon Coleman. He also plays guitar for the band. His voice is a key part of their distinct sound, and he’s been with the group since it formed in 2016. He’s pretty much the voice you hear on all their songs.

Where are The Red Clay Strays from?

The Red Clay Strays hail from Mobile, Alabama. That's where the band originally formed back in 2016, starting out as a successor to a cover band. Their roots in Mobile have, arguably, influenced their southern rock sound.

Is Brandon Coleman married?

Yes, Brandon Coleman is married. He tied the knot with his childhood sweetheart, Macie Coleman, on April 1st. His wife has even shared public reactions to his performances, showing her support for his music career.
